Vulcain Engineering is seeking a Mechanical Contract Lead in Bristol for a major nuclear access systems programme. You will oversee mechanical packages, review designs, and ensure safe integration with lifting and handling interfaces on a high-profile UK project.
The role requires experience in safety-critical engineering, strong stakeholder communication, and the ability to coordinate across disciplines in a regulated environment.

Due to ongoing business growth, we are expanding our technical teams in Bristol and looking to hire an experienced Mechanical Engineer to join Vulcain on a full-time permanent basis, to play an integral part of our major nuclear new build programmes.
The Mechanical Engineer will support the design and integration of industrial door systems and lifting/handling interfaces on a major nuclear new build programme. The role sits within a high-performing engineering team and will focus on safety-critical access systems and their integration within complex plant environments.
